In his expanded role as COO, Coren is responsible for new business development and partnering with Wei Wei Chen, chairman and CEO of Leo Burnett Group Shanghai, to supervise daily operation, in addition to overseeing the Coca Cola account and other multi-national clients.
A 15-year veteran in marketing communications, Coren possesses a breath of know-how across disciplines, industries and markets. He has experience spanning APAC, Europe and the U.S. Prior to joining Red Lounge to lead some of the most remarkable creative campaigns for
Coke in China, Coren was the Managing Director for Leo Burnett Bangkok. His international client portfolio includes Heineken, Diageo, Kraft Foods, General Motors, Kimberly Clark and more.
The two veteran Burnetters, Amanda Yang and Gordon Hughes, were both appointed as Co-Executive Creative Directors of Shanghai office in June 2009.
Yang moved to Leo Burnett Shanghai in June for this appointment from the Guangzhou office, where she played a critical role in orchestrating award-winning campaigns for P&G Tide, Gain, Whisper, Vidal Sassoon, along with other local clients. Prior to Leo Burnett Guangzhou, Amanda was a Creative Director at Y&R Southern China.
Hughes, married to Yang, has been a Burnetter for over ten years. He was most recently Managing Director for DDB Guangzhou before returning to Leo Burnett Shanghai in June. Prior to DDB, he was the Group Creative Director for Leo Burnett Hong Kong, where he worked on Hennessy, Prudential, IFC and several P&G brands. Besides Hong Kong, Hughes also worked before at Leo Burentt Taiwan and Guangzhou.
